First Movement ETF Filing Will Provide U.S. Investors with Exposure to Movement Ecosystem

GRAND CAYMAN, Cayman Islands, March 10,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- The Movement Network Foundation, the organization dedicated to advancing MoveVM technology, today announced that REX-Osprey has filed for a new exchange-traded fund (ETF) focused on $MOVE. If approved, this ETF would be the first providing exposure to Movement through traditional financial rails. Simultaneously, the Foundation announced the successful launch of Movement Public Mainnet Beta, with $250M in at-launch Total Value Locked (TVL) from its Cornucopia program.

"This filing represents a historic moment not just for Movement, but for the entire Move landscape," said Rushi Manche, Co-Founder of Movement Labs. "Breaking the pattern of ETFs limited to long-established cryptocurrencies opens doors for institutional capital to support next-generation blockchain innovation."

"Traditional investors have expressed keen interest in gaining regulated exposure to emerging blockchain technologies without directly managing tokens," noted Cooper Scanlon, Co-Founder of Movement Labs. "This ETF represents the convergence of innovative financial products with cutting-edge blockchain architecture."

ETF Provides Traditional Market Access to $MOVE
The Move programming language, originally developed by Meta, empowers Movement developers to create more efficient, more secure smart contracts. If approved, the ETF would allow investors to gain exposure to Movement through traditional brokerage accounts and retirement vehicles without the technical complexities of direct token management.

Public Mainnet Beta Launches with Substantial Liquidity
Concurrent with the ETF filing announcement, Movement Network Foundation has successfully launched its Public Mainnet Beta with $250M in Total Value Locked (TVL). This day-one liquidity provides the network with immediate utility.

The Public Mainnet Beta enables permissionless smart contract deployment, full user onboarding, and Ethereum settlement. It gives users and builders the full benefits of Move and the MoveVM. Users can access the network through the canonical Movement bridge powered by LayerZero.

LAS VEGAS, Jan. 9, 2026 /PRNewswire/ -- Guide Sensmart (Booth 21740, Central Hall), a global leader in thermal imaging technology, officially launched its next-generation thermal imaging innovation – ApexVision – alongside a series of new products empowered by the technology. This launch represents a systemic leap for the industry from merely "seeing heat" to "seeing with clarity, precision, and intelligence," marking the dawn of a new era defined by Ultra-Clarity.

CES Show Floor Reaction: "Ultra-Clarity" Draws Deep Engagement

At the Guide Sensmart booth, live product demonstrations powered by ApexVision attracted strong attention from industry analysts to global media. Hands-on comparisons—such as maintaining clear imaging details of distant targets and delivering crisp, smear-free imaging of fast-moving objects—earned consistent praise. Many professional visitors noted that this reliable "what-you-see-is-what-you-get" clarity would directly enhance operational efficiency and decision-making confidence.

ApexVision integrating both hardware and software: It combines the high-sensitivity ApexCore S1 detector, the Nexus 1.0 processing platform, and scenario-optimized algorithms. Together, ApexVision successfully overcomes persistent challenges such as low contrast in complex environments, detail loss at long range or high magnification, motion blur on fast-moving objects, and inaccurate detection of minute temperature differences.

From Architecture to Application: A Full Portfolio Empowered

On the CES show floor, Guide Sensmart demonstrated how ApexVision delivers tangible improvements across thermal devices. Thermography tools (e.g. E3S, H6S thermal cameras) leverage the SharpIR 2.0 algorithm to provide stable, accurate temperature measurement in demanding environments, enabling inspectors to pinpoint hidden faults with greater confidence. Outdoor hunting optics (e.g. TD650LS monocular and TN650MS binocular), benefit from Hyper-Light 2.0, allowing users to identify nocturnal wildlife in complete darkness and track fast-moving targets while maintaining clean, sharp images even at 10× zoom.
